Scattering and Blow up for the Two Dimensional Focusing Quintic Nonlinear Schr\"odinger Equation
Using the concentration-compactness method and the localized virial type
arguments, we study the behavior of solutions to the focusing quintic NLS
in , namely,
Denoting by and , the mass and energy of a solution
respectively, and the ground state solution to , and
assuming , we characterize the threshold for global versus
finite time existence. Moreover, we show scattering for global existing time
solutions and finite or "weak" blow up for the complement region. This work is
in the spirit of Kenig and Merle and Duyckaerts, Holmer, and Roudenko.Comment: 37 pages, 2 figures and updated reference
